Spleen and kidney deficiency is explained from the perspective of traditional Chinese medicine. When women suffer from spleen and kidney deficiency, they will show many symptoms, which often cause soreness in the waist and knees, leading to physical fatigue, frequent night sweats, dizziness, tinnitus and other symptoms. In addition, it will cause certain digestive tract symptoms, such as abdominal pain, diarrhea, nausea, vomiting, loss of appetite, pale complexion and other symptoms. Spleen deficiency 1. Refers to the pathogenesis of spleen qi being weak and unable to raise clearness. Deficiency of spleen and kidney Deficiency of spleen and kidney It is mostly caused by spleen yang deficiency and insufficient qi in the middle. Symptoms include dull complexion, dizziness, easy sweating, shortness of breath, poor appetite, fatigue, abdominal distension, loose stools or blurred vision, deafness, loss of taste in food, pale and tender tongue, white tongue coating, and weak pulse. If the spleen qi fails to rise due to dampness and food stagnation, symptoms include heaviness in the head, fatigue, loss of appetite, abdominal distension or pain, thick and greasy tongue coating, and a deep and slow pulse. 2. Refers to digestive dysfunction of the spleen and stomach. It is mostly caused by liver failure to release qi or dampness blocking spleen yang, but can also be caused by food stagnation. The main symptoms include abdominal distension, indigestion, anorexia, hiccups, etc. 3. Refers to the pathogenesis of abnormal spleen function. The spleen is responsible for transportation and transformation. If the spleen yang is deficient, the spleen will fail to perform its transportation and transformation duties and will be unable to raise clear substances. In mild cases, there will be symptoms of indigestion such as abdominal distension, poor appetite, intestinal rumbling, and diarrhea; if it lasts for a long time, the patient will have a sallow face, thin muscles, and weak limbs; if water and dampness are blocked, the limbs will swell, or the water and dampness will turn into phlegm or fluid, causing other phlegm or fluid symptoms. Kidney deficiency 1. Kidney Yin deficiency is caused by insufficient kidney water and relatively hyperactive kidney Yang and liver fire. The causes include damage to sperm, loss of blood, loss of fluid, and acute fever causing damage to kidney yin. The main symptoms are low back pain, fatigue, dizziness, tinnitus, insomnia, forgetfulness, spermatorrhea, premature ejaculation, amenorrhea and infertility, dry mouth and sore throat, hot flashes in the afternoon, slightly red cheekbones, fever in the five parts of the body, red tongue without coating, and deep and fine pulse. 2. Kidney Yang Deficiency Kidney Yang is the driving force behind the body's functional activities. When kidney Yang is weak, the body's functional activities will be impaired. The main symptoms are pale complexion, lack of energy, fear of cold, decreased physical strength, sore waist and weak legs, impotence and premature ejaculation, decreased libido, oliguria and edema, poor appetite and loose stools, tender and plump tongue, white and slippery tongue coating, and deep and weak pulse. |
